Read MoreStock Market News From Oct. 14, 2025: Dow Turns Higher in Big Reversal
The Dow Jones Industrial Average rode its biggest intraday comeback since April to close higher on Tuesday, but the S&P 500 stumbled late after trade tensions with China flared up again.
The Dow rose 203 points, or 0.4%. The S&P 500 dropped 0.2%. The Nasdaq Composite fell 0.8%.

Read MoreMIT graduates, accused of $25 million cryptocurrency fraud, blame it on ‘lack of government regulations’
Two MIT-educated brothers, Anton (25) and James Peraire-Bueno (29), are on trial in Manhattan. They allegedly carried out a $25 million cryptocurrency heist on the Ethereum blockchain in April 2023.
Prosecutors say the brothers designed a “first-of-its-kind” fraud scheme that took months of planning. However, they executed it in just 12 seconds.
Micron Pulls Out Of China Data Center Market After Ban
Micron Technology Inc. (NASDAQ:MU) shares fell 3.84% in pre-market trading on Friday after a report emerged that the U.S. chipmaker will withdraw from China’s data center market, ending a difficult chapter marked by Beijing’s 2023 ban on its products in critical infrastructure.
